Volkswagen Golf Service & Repair Manual: Pipes and hoses in refrigerant circuit

The mixture of refrigerant oil and refrigerant R134a attacks certain metals (e.g. copper) and alloys and dissolves certain hose materials. Therefore, always use genuine replacement parts.
The hoses and pipes are held together with screwed joints or special push-fit joints.
  Note
When assembling screwed joints, be careful to comply with the prescribed torques, and when working on push-fit joints, be careful to use the disconnection tools provided.
